Just been looking at England's performances in major championships since 1980. Even when we got to the semi-finals in 1990 and 1996 we had a total of 3 wins and 8 draws in 12 games after 90 minutes over the course of both tournaments.

Just to reiterate, I'm talking about games over 90 minutes and not extra-time and penalties. For balance I've included those stats at the bottom of the page.

1980 - P3 W1 D1 L1
1982 - P5 W3 D2 L0
1986 - P5 W2 D1 L2
1988 - P3 W0 D0 L3
1990 - P7 W1 D5 L1
1992 - P3 W0 D2 L1
1996 - P5 W2 D3 L0
1998 - P4 W2 D1 L1
2000 - P3 W1 D0 L2
2002 - P5 W2 D2 L1
2004 - P4 W2 D1 L1
2006 - P5 W3 D2 L0
2010 - P4 W1 D2 L1

1980-2010 - P56 W20 D22 L14 in 90 minutes
1980-2010 - P56 W22 D20 L14 including extra-time
1980-2010 - P56 W23 D14 L19 including extra-time and penalty shoot-outs

Beat in 90 minutes: Spain, France, Czechoslovakia, Kuwait, Poland, Paraquay (2), Egypt, Scotland, Holland, Tunisia, Colombia, Germany, Argentina, Denmark (2), Croatia, Trinidad & Tobago, Ecuador

Lost in 90 minutes: Italy (2), Portugal (2), Argentina, Republic of Ireland, Holland, Soviet Union, Sweden, Romania (2), Brazil, France, Germany

Beat after extra-time and penalties: Belgium, Cameroon, Spain
Lost after extra-time and penalties: (West) Germany (2), Argentina, Portugal (2)

Just a point of remembrance today is the 53rd Anniversery since the Munich Air Disaster. To mark the day I've been watching a documentary about goalkeeper Harry Gregg who bravely rescued many passengers during the crash- including Matt Busby, Bobby Charlton and Dennis Violet. Plus he saved a Yugoslavian citizen named Vera Lukic during the crash and her two year old daughter. Plus Vera Lukic was also pregnant at the time. It's a very touching documentary that was aired for the 50th anniversery three years ago where Gregg goes back to Belgrade where United were playing on the 5th of February and then to Munich airport where the plane was sent for re-fuelling where on take off led to the crash. Shows what a hero and legend Gregg is. I recommend you give it a watch: http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=6cS9i52eyeI
